India Unveils Advanced Biomanufacturing Hubs: Propelling the Nation Towards a $300 Billion Bio-Economy by 2030

India is embarking on a transformative journey, setting its sights firmly on becoming a global leader in sustainable innovation with the ambitious launch of Advanced Biomanufacturing Hubs and comprehensive National Guidelines. This groundbreaking initiative, spearheaded by the government, is poised to dramatically accelerate the nation's burgeoning bio-economy, charting a course towards a greener, more self-reliant future.

The momentous launch was officiated by Dr.

Jitendra Singh, the Union Minister of State (Independent Charge) for Science & Technology, who articulated a powerful vision. The core objective is to position India as a premier destination for biomanufacturing – a sector that leverages biological systems and processes to produce a wide array of goods, from advanced materials and biofuels to pharmaceuticals and chemicals.

This strategic move is not just about economic growth; it's about fundamentally reshaping India's industrial landscape with sustainability at its heart.

The numbers tell a compelling story of India's bio-economy trajectory. From a modest $10 billion in 2014, it has surged to an impressive $130 billion in 2024.

Now, with these new initiatives, the nation is boldly targeting an astounding $300 billion by 2030. This isn't merely an incremental increase; it represents a dedicated, strategic push to harness the power of biotechnology for massive economic expansion and environmental benefit.

A central pillar of this new strategy is a fervent commitment to sustainable manufacturing practices.

The Advanced Biomanufacturing Hubs are designed to foster the development and adoption of processes that significantly reduce reliance on fossil fuels, minimize waste, and mitigate environmental impact. This translates into the creation of a vast number of 'green jobs' – employment opportunities rooted in environmentally friendly industries – simultaneously boosting self-reliance and contributing to a cleaner, healthier planet for all.

Complementing the physical infrastructure of the hubs are the robust 'National Guidelines for Advanced Biomanufacturing'.

These guidelines are envisioned as a powerful catalyst for innovation, providing a clear framework to stimulate research and development, nurture entrepreneurial ventures, and cultivate a highly skilled workforce. They will play a crucial role in standardizing best practices and accelerating the translation of scientific discoveries into marketable, sustainable products.

India's proactive steps are further solidifying its standing on the global stage.

Already recognized among the top 12 global biotech destinations and holding the prestigious position of the third-largest in the Asia-Pacific region, these new initiatives are set to elevate India's prominence even further. The government's vision is clear: to not only meet domestic needs but also emerge as a significant global exporter of biomanufactured products and expertise.

The transition from a 'linear' (take-make-dispose) to a 'circular' economy is a key philosophical underpinning of this drive.

Biomanufacturing inherently supports this shift by promoting resource efficiency, recycling, and the creation of biodegradable products. Dr. Singh underscored the critical importance of synergistic collaboration between government agencies, industry leaders, and academic institutions. This 'whole of government and whole of society' approach is deemed essential for fostering an ecosystem ripe for innovation and successful implementation.
